Cannot get sonarr to move files downloaded via download station

Sonarr version (exact version): 3.0.7.1477
Mono version (if Sonarr is not running on Windows):
OS: windows 11
Debug logs:
Description of issue: Cannot get sonarr to move files downloaded via download station. Sonarr sends torrent to nas fine it downloads etc. My path is 192.168.1.251
\Mediaserver\Downloaded\COMPLETED\ Root path for nas is [\Mediaserver\Downloaded\TV]
But every download says
2022-04-22 11:55:58.8|Warn|ArgumentValidator|value [ \Mediaserver\Downloaded\COMPLETED] is not a valid Windows path. paths must be a full path eg. C:\Windows
Sonarr is not running as a service but is in the system tray and startup I do not see a service running for sonar

You’ll need to setup a remote path mapping to remap the path reported by download client to one that Sonarr on a different OS is able to access.

I have a remote path set up but sonarr seems to demand a local path to access the remote path? I don’t seem to understand and I have read the wiki on the subject but nothing seems to work. Am I required to map the remote directory? I’d really rather not have a torrent downloader installed on my local pc that is why I am trying to use download station on the nas

yea I don’t get it remote path is set etc and still get errors

  • [/volume1/Downloaded/COMPLETED/S.W.A.T.2017.S05E16.HDTV.x264-TORRENTGALAXY[TGx]] is not a valid local path. You may need a Remote Path Mapping.

You need to mount that remote directory somewhere local, then you use the Remote Path Mapping in Sonarr to tell Sonarr where to look for those files.
